Meta has released Muse Glimmer, a slimmed-down open-weight AI model designed to run locally on a single GPU for agent tasks such as scheduling, file management, coding, and tool use. The release is based on Meta's closed Muse Spark 1.2 model and appears to be aimed at attracting developers who want capable AI agents without relying entirely on cloud-hosted services. Engadget reports: Facebook said that it's making the "weights" that AI systems use to choose responses available to everyone on Hugging Face along with developer documentation. The download is available for free, and users can run the model on their own PCs.
